Consumer Price Index CPI in Tunisia increased to 190.90 points in February from 190.80 points in January of 2026. Consumer Price Index CPI in Tunisia averaged 54.77 points from 1962 until 2026, reaching an all time high of 190.90 points in February of 2026 and a record low of 6.76 points in August of 1962. source: National Institute of Statistics - Tunisia

Tunisia Consumer Price Index (CPI)
In Tunisia, the Consumer Price Index or CPI measures changes in the prices paid by consumers for a basket of goods and services.
